			            Original DescriptionMarco Grubas’ Am Markusplatz In Venedig captures the timeless allure of Venice’s iconic St. Mark’s Square with remarkable atmospheric depth. The painting likely depicts the bustling piazza bathed in golden light, where the intricate Byzantine arches of the Basilica contrast with lively crowds and fluttering pigeons—hallmarks of Venetian vedute tradition. Grubas’ impressionistic brushwork, playing with light reflections on wet cobblestones and architectural details, suggests influences from both 19th-century European plein air painting and modern tonalism. Historically significant as part of Europe’s enduring fascination with Venetian cityscapes that began with Canaletto, this work bridges documentary precision and emotional resonance. The artist’s handling of translucent shadows and warm ochers would place this within late 20th-century interpretations of classic Italian subjects, offering nostalgia through a contemporary lens while maintaining technical rigor characteristic of academic training.
